/*
* WAPF defines the behavior of the Fn+Fx wlan key
* The significance of values is yet to be found, but
* most of the time:
* Bit | Bluetooth | WLAN
* 0 | Hardware | Hardware
* 1 | Hardware | Software
* 4 | Software | Software
*/
static uint wapf;
module_param(wapf, uint, 0444);
MODULE_PARM_DESC(wapf, "WAPF value");

static void asus_nb_wmi_quirks(struct asus_wmi_driver *driver)
{
driver->wapf = wapf;
}
